Designing effective spectator systems requires developers to think differently from traditional gameplay design. Teams associated with topics discussed under jilix frequently focus on camera controls, information displays, replay tools, and visual indicators that help audiences understand ongoing action. Competitive games often contain numerous simultaneous events, making it difficult for viewers to recognize important developments without assistance. Spectator interfaces must present relevant information while avoiding unnecessary clutter. Automatic camera systems, player statistics, and strategic overviews can help explain situations that might otherwise be confusing. Developers must also account for both experienced fans and newcomers who may be unfamiliar with game mechanics. Through careful design choices, spectator features become valuable educational tools as well as entertainment platforms.
